To be a journeyman electrical expert indicates to be on the second level of standing in a three-phase electric profession. The phases are as complies with: apprentice, journeyman, and master electrical expert.

A lot of a journeyman's job includes installing, linking, inspecting, repairing, and preserving electrical systems and parts, including electrical wiring, outlets, home appliances, electric switches, breaker, safety and security systems, and lights


All journeyman and master electrical contractors must be certified to legitimately work. Some go to technological school, while others are trained via an apprenticeship. Apprenticeships often last three to 5 years and are supplied by various companies, local unions, or accredited electrical experts going to coach and have a person work under them. Apprentices need to track their hours and full 4,000 to 8,000 hours on the job (relying on the program) prior to qualifying to take a journeyman's exam.


For this, journeymen must have an eye for detail while having the ability to solve complex problems as they occur. Preserving documents and having a declaring system for points like inventory lists and task logs is vital, making company an additional vital facet of the work. While some tasks allow electrical contractors to work alone, lots of need communication with clients, supervisors, and apprentices, so a journeyman ought to know exactly how to work and collaborate with others.

According to Indeed, journeyperson electrical experts in the USA make an average base wage of around $61,000 annually based on information reported by individuals and job posts from business. Glassdoor shows an ordinary base wage of $68,000 for journeyman electrical contractors, varying based on years of experience and location. As an upkeep electrical expert, you are entrusted with preserving, repairing, and upgrading existing electrical tools. Other maintenance duties consist of screening, troubleshooting, and identifying problems with equipment. To function as an upkeep electrical contractor, you would also require an official apprenticeship, with on-the-job technical training, adhered to by an electrical expert permit.
